    private String writeOpml(){
    XmlSerializer serializer = Xml.newSerializer();
    StringWriter writer = new StringWriter();
    try {
      serializer.setOutput(writer);
      serializer.startDocument("UTF-8", true);
      serializer.startTag("", "opml");
      serializer.attribute("", "version", "1.1");
      serializer.startTag("", "head");
      serializer.startTag("", "title");
      serializer.text("Hapi Podcast Feeds");      
      serializer.endTag("", "title");
      serializer.endTag("", "head");
      
      
      serializer.startTag("", "body");      
      //serializer.startTag("", "outline");

      Cursor cursor = managedQuery(SubscriptionColumns.URI, SubscriptionColumns.ALL_COLUMNS,
          null, null, null);
      
      if (cursor !=null & cursor.moveToFirst()) {
        do{

          Subscription channel = Subscription.getByCursor(cursor);

          if(channel!=null){
            serializer.startTag("", "outline");
            serializer.attribute("", "title", channel.title);
            serializer.attribute("", "xmlUrl", channel.url);            
            serializer.endTag("", "outline");
          }

        }while (cursor.moveToNext());

      }
      
      if(cursor!=null)
        cursor.close();
      
      
      //serializer.endTag("", "outline");
      serializer.endTag("", "body");    
      serializer.endTag("", "opml");
      serializer.endDocument();

      return writer.toString();
    } catch (Exception e) {
      e.printStackTrace();
      
    } 
    
    return null;
  }

    private void readZipXmlEntry(ZipInputStream zis, ZipEntry entry, String baseName) {
      try {
        DocumentBuilderFactory factory = DocumentBuilderFactory.newInstance();
        DocumentBuilder builder = factory.newDocumentBuilder();
        //DocumentBuilder.parse(InputStream) closes the stream when it is done,
        //which fails for us because we need to keep it open for the next entry,
        //so we read the current input data into a buffer and parse it from there.
        ByteArrayOutputStream bos = new ByteArrayOutputStream();
        FileUtils.copyFile(zis, bos);
        byte[] contents = bos.toByteArray();
        ByteArrayInputStream bis = new ByteArrayInputStream(contents);
        Document dom = builder.parse(bis);
        Element root = dom.getDocumentElement();
        String rootName = root.getTagName();
        if (rootName.equals("subscription"))
          readZipXmlSubscription(zis,root);
        else if (rootName.equals("episode"))
          readZipXmlEpisode(zis,root,baseName);
        else {
          throw new RuntimeException("Unknown root element '"+rootName+"'");
        }
      }
      catch (Exception e) {
        e.printStackTrace(System.err);            
      }
    }
